2023 Les Dolomies Cotes du Jura 'Croix Sarrant' Savagnin, France
$64.00
The plot is located in the commune of Château Chalon, bordering Nevy-sur-Seille. It is a rare, flat plot in this area, situated on ochre-colored marly limestone (Lias marl). There is a significant presence of limestone. The plot faces southeast.
This Savagnin spent 24 months in 228L oak barrels after complete fermentation in tanks. Bottled in mid-November 2025 without sulfites or filtration.
